    Abstract

    Electrical power, changing with differential group delay (DGD) and detected from an optical communication link, can be used as feedback signals of compensating for PMD. Theoretical calculations and curves are given representing the change of electrical power with DGD. Experimental results confirming the theoretical calculations are presented for voltage V changing with DGD. A setup is built for experiments of PMD compensations. Several factors affecting the feedback signals are proposed and methods are given to make the fluctuations less. Results of PMD compensation prototype for a 10 Gb/s pseudo random sequence are shown through eye patterns. These results are also shown by receiver sensitivity improvements after compensation. Receiver sensitivity under 3 different bit error rates are measured using BER measuring equipment. Comparisons of results using different fibers are made,confirming the effectiveness of compensation.
